摘要
For the problem that the traditional single position control mode is difficult to meet the requirements of high-performance position control,this paper proposes a predictive control mode self-switching method for permanent magnet synchronous motor position control. This paper firstly studied the predictive current control mode, predictive speed control mode and predictive position control mode, analyzed and compared the characteristics of these three control modes,and then divided the position control process into four stages according to the motor control objectives, and adopted corresponding control methods in different operating stages. It also proposed a smooth self-switching method of control mode based on the selection of different switching points,and finally realized a position control method with predictive control mode self-switching. Finally, coparative experiments of proposed method and traditional methods were conducted to verify the effectiveness and superiority of proposed method in aspects of both dynamic performance and steady-state performance. © 2022 Editorial Department of Electric Machines and Control.
